Output 13a3217df9d0d9465a75f5c9bb125eaae483b41eb853990ea12fba7d2f4f8425:0

value
75000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cab745610f9081dc43f3b93aea03fc9162f3e0c OP_EQUAL
address
MR6kfMgxvsLYsUFFdpXaRSden3xQZ168XT
transaction
13a3217df9d0d9465a75f5c9bb125eaae483b41eb853990ea12fba7d2f4f8425
spent
true